目标跟踪的运动控制方法、装置、计算机设备及存储介质制造方法及图纸

技术编号:24289419 阅读:28 留言:0更新日期:2020-05-26 19:56
本发明专利技术公开了一种目标跟踪的运动控制方法、装置、计算机设备及存储介质,其中,获取跟踪目标的第一目标速度;在加速时间小于或者等于切换时间的情况下,根据第一算法模型将摄像机的云台上电机移动的第一速度加速至第二速度;该切换时间为将该第一算法模型切换第二算法模型的时间;在该加速时间大于该切换时间的情况下,根据该第二算法模型将该云台上电机移动的该第二速度加速至该第一目标速度,从而高效合理地利用了电机在该第一速度和第二速度下输出的力矩,提高了电机输出力矩的有效利用率,解决了在目标跟踪过程中云台移动稳、准、快无法兼顾的问题。

Motion control method, device, computer equipment and storage medium of target tracking

【技术实现步骤摘要】
目标跟踪的运动控制方法、装置、计算机设备及存储介质
本申请涉及视频监控
,特别是涉及一种目标跟踪的运动控制方法、装置、计算机设备及存储介质。
技术介绍
随着人工智能技术的发展,用户对摄像机智能目标跟踪效果的要求也越来越高;目标跟踪过程中通过云台带动摄像机运动,从而实现该摄像机对目标的跟踪和监控。在相关技术中,步进电机驱动该摄像机的云台从一个位置移动到另一个位置时,一般要经历加速、匀速和减速过程;但步进电机存在中高速下输出力矩小,容易失步和堵转的缺点,导致移动位置不准,因此在目标跟踪过程中云台启动快速性、平稳性和高精度无法兼顾。针对相关技术中,在目标跟踪过程中云台移动稳、准、快无法兼顾的问题,目前尚未提出有效的解决方案。
技术实现思路
针对相关技术中,在目标跟踪过程中云台移动稳、准、快无法兼顾的问题,本专利技术提供了一种目标跟踪的运动控制方法、装置、计算机设备及存储介质,以至少解决上述问题。根据本专利技术的一个方面,提供了一种目标跟踪的运动控制方法,所述方法包括:获取跟踪目标的第一目标速度;...

【技术保护点】
1.一种目标跟踪的运动控制方法,其特征在于,所述方法包括:/n获取跟踪目标的第一目标速度;/n在加速时间小于或者等于切换时间的情况下,根据第一算法模型将摄像机的云台移动的第一速度加速至第二速度;所述切换时间为将所述第一算法模型切换至第二算法模型的时间;/n在所述加速时间大于所述切换时间的情况下,根据所述第二算法模型将所述云台移动的所述第二速度加速至所述第一目标速度。/n

【技术特征摘要】
1.一种目标跟踪的运动控制方法,其特征在于,所述方法包括:
获取跟踪目标的第一目标速度;
在加速时间小于或者等于切换时间的情况下,根据第一算法模型将摄像机的云台移动的第一速度加速至第二速度;所述切换时间为将所述第一算法模型切换至第二算法模型的时间;
在所述加速时间大于所述切换时间的情况下,根据所述第二算法模型将所述云台移动的所述第二速度加速至所述第一目标速度。


2.根据权利要求1所述的方法,其特征在于,所述在加速时间小于或者等于切换时间的情况下,根据第一算法模型将摄像机的云台移动的第一速度加速至第二速度包括:
在所述第一算法模型为指数算法模型的情况下,获取所述摄像机和所述云台的设备参数,根据所述设备参数和所述第一目标速度获取所述指数算法模型的上升时间参数,根据所述上升时间参数确定所述指数算法模型;
根据所述指数算法模型将所述第一速度加速至所述第二速度。


3.根据权利要求1或2所述的方法,其特征在于,所述在所述加速时间大于所述切换时间的情况下,根据所述第二算法模型将所述云台上电机移动的所述第二速度加速至所述第一目标速度包括:
在所述第二算法模型为S曲线算法模型的情况下,获取所述摄像机和所述云台的设备参数,根据所述设备参数获取最大加速度,并根据所述切换时间获取所述S曲线算法模型的最大加加速度,根据所述最大加速度和所述最大加加速度确定所述S曲线算法模型;
根据所述S曲线算法模型将所述第二速度加速至所述第一目标速度。


4.根据权利要求1所述的方法,其特征在于,所述在加速时间小于或者等于切换时间的情况下,根据第一算法模型将云台的第一速度加速至第二速度之前,所述方法还包括:
获取所述云台上电机的矩频特性的拐点参数,根据所述拐点参数确定所述云台移动的第三速度;
在所述第三速度大于或者等于所述第一目标速度的情况下,将所述切换时间设置为所述第一算法模型的上升时间;
在所述第三速度小于所述第一目标速度的情况下,获取所述云台的当前CPU占用率,在所述当前CPU占用率大于第一阈值的情况下,将所述切换时间设置为所述第一算法模型的上升时间;在所述当前CPU占用率小于第二阈值的情况下,将所述切换时间设置为所述矩频特性的拐点时间;其中,所述第一阈值大于所述第二阈值;
在外界负载大于预设负载的情况下,将所述切换时间设置为所述拐点时间。


5.根据权利要求1所述的方法,其特征在于,所述根据所述第二算法模型将所述第二速度加速至所述第一目标速度之后,所述方法还包括:
在接收停止跟踪指令的情况下,根据加速过程的逆过程将所述第一目标速度进行减速;其中,所述加速过程为将所述第一速度加速至所述第一目标速度的过程。


6.根据权利要求1所述的方法,其特征在于,所述获取跟踪目标的第一目标速度之后,所述方法还包括:
获取所述跟踪目标的定位距离,并根据距离公式确定所述云台在加速过程和减速过程的第一运动距离;
在所述定位距离小于所述第一运动距离的情况下,根据所述定位距离获取第二目标速度;
根据切换时间、第一算法模型和第...

【专利技术属性】
技术研发人员:陈明珠杨增启徐志永吴惠敏
申请(专利权)人:浙江大华技术股份有限公司
类型:发明
国别省市:浙江;33

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1